Includes:

US Army:

Vehicles
M1A1 Abrams
M2A2 Bradley
HMMWV (.50cal and variants)
HMMWV TOW
HMMWV Avenger
DPV
UH-60 Blackhawk
AH64A Apache
A-10 Thunderbolt II
F-16C Falcon

Weapons
CAR-15
SMAW
FIM-92A Stinger
M2HB MG
M240 MG

Iraq

Vehicles
T-72
BRDM-2
BRDM-2 Spandrel
BRDM-2 Gaskin
UAZ (.50 Cal and variant)
Mi-17 Hip
Mi-24D Hind
Su-25A Frogfoot
MiG-29 Fulcrum

Weapons
RPG-7
SA-7 Grail
Browning Hi-Powered
NSV(T) MG

From what I've seen, there are all new sounds and about 5-6 maps -- there is even a Battle of 73 Eastings, and a docks map.

Only bug so far is that the Hind lags.

The tanks have switchable ammo like POE1.

You can blow up a jeep or light apc with one tank round.

Its a pretty good mod, the apache and the hind are absoloutely kicking the shit out of most maps though. I never thought the laser guided missile would be a pilots secondary weapon, taking out tanks is so simple with it. Funny as hell to see tank drivers dive out everytime they get the lockon sound though. biggrin:

Also a really nice feel to the apache, really agile now compared to the supercobra in bf2, just wonder why they never included the radar dome on the model, almost seems to be the same apache from bf2:sf besides that.

Also like the fact tanks have 2 shells now and a zoom in function, long range tank battle are the shit on dc_eastings. rock:
